Summary

Blade, a half-human, half-vampire hunter, discovers a vampire conspiracy to awaken an ancient vampire god. Armed with special weapons and knowledge of vampire weaknesses, he fights to prevent a war between the vampire underground and human society. His quest leads him to confront both the vampire elite and his own mysterious past.

Blade (1998) is a film IMDb files under the action, horror and thriller genres. It stars Wesley Snipes, Stephen Dorff and Kris Kristofferson. It was made in the United States. It is rated R. The runtime is 120 minutes. It was directed by Stephen Norrington.

How the score was built

We compare the reviewers of this title against every other title those same people reviewed. Each review is scored relative to the reviewer's own baseline — a 7/10 from a hard grader sits well above their average, while a 7/10 from a generous grader sits below theirs. Every reviewer then counts the same, so the result is a calibrated consensus rather than a raw average.

AI-adjusted percentile
The same reviewer-normalized score, corrected for how much confidence the sample supports: thin samples are pulled toward the corpus average. Each title keeps the share n / (n + 53) of its measured distance from the average, where n is its calibrated-reviewer count, and the result is ranked on the same scale as the global percentile.53 is the median sample size across everything we rank.
